Design and Electronics

The Chicago Bass utilizes a 'PJ' pickup configuration, combining a split-coil pickup with a single-coil pickup. This layout is intended to provide a broad tonal palette.

  • Split-coil pickup: Delivers thick, rounded, and classic bass tones.
  • Single-coil pickup: Provides increased edge, bite, and definition for modern styles.

The instrument features independent volume knobs for each pickup and dedicated tone knobs, allowing players to roll off treble for a warmer sound or dial in specific levels for a customised output.

Sound Character

Due to its hybrid pickup design, the Chicago Bass is described as a 'tone-machine'. The split-coil unit captures the traditional low-end thump associated with vintage instruments, while the single-coil bridge pickup offers the clarity required for more percussive playing styles. The electronics allow the user to transition between smooth, mellow textures and aggressive, cutting sounds by adjusting the onboard controls.

Comparison to Alternatives

Within the Gear4Music range, the Sunburst pack sits alongside variations like the Trans Red Burst version or the Chicago Fretless variant for players seeking a different feel. Compared to more affordable options like the VISIONSTRING Bass Pack, the Chicago series offers a more complex pickup configuration. While it provides a functional entry point, it differs from premium instruments such as the Fender Player II series or the American Professional II Jazz Bass, which utilize different woods and high-end hardware. For those seeking active electronics or five-string options, the Squier Classic Vibe Active 70s Jazz Bass V serves as a more advanced alternative.
